Our analysis reveals clear seasonal patterns in WiFi router pricing. Here's a comprehensive breakdown of what you can expect each month:
Month | Discount Range | Sale Frequency | Major Events | Worth Waiting? |
---|---|---|---|---|
January | 14.8-19.5% | Medium | Post-holiday clearance | Maybe |
February | 9.0-13.2% | Low | Presidents' Day | No |
March | 9.2-15.9% | Low | Spring sales | No |
April | 4.6-9.5% | Low | Easter sales | No |
May | 9.4-15.3% | Medium | Memorial Day | Maybe |
June | 5.7-9.3% | Low | Summer sales | No |
July | 14.7-18.5% | Medium | Amazon Prime Day | Yes ⭐ |
August | 12.1-13.9% | Medium | Back-to-school | Yes |
September | 9.9-14.6% | Medium | Labor Day | Yes |
October | 12.8-24.5% | High | October Prime Day | Maybe |
November | 20.2-27.7% | High | Black Friday | Yes ⭐⭐ |
December | 12.6-23.9% | High | Holiday sales | Yes |
The table reveals four key "sweet spots" for router purchases throughout the year: April, July, August, and September. Let's examine why these months stand out:
July (Amazon Prime Day): Mid-July brings consistent discounts of 14.7-18.5%, centered around Amazon Prime Day. All major router brands participate in this event, making it an excellent opportunity if you need a router in mid-year.
August-September (Back-to-School & Labor Day): As manufacturers prepare to release new models in late Q3/early Q4, retailers discount existing inventory. These months consistently offer 9.2-14.6% off across most brands.
November (Black Friday/Cyber Monday): The champion of router discounts, with savings of 20.2-36.5% off MSRP. If you can wait until late November, this is unquestionably the best time to buy any router brand.
April (Spring Clearance): While discounts are modest at 4.6-9.5%, April represents a relative low point in the pricing cycle, making it better than adjacent months.

If you're wondering whether to buy now or wait for a better deal, here's a practical guide to the savings potential at different times of the year:
Current Month | Wait Until | Potential Savings | Worth the Wait? |
---|---|---|---|
January | July (Prime Day) | 9.4-12.5% more off | Yes, if not urgent |
February | April | 4.5-9.5% more off | No, minimal savings |
March | April | 5.0-9.6% more off | No, minimal savings |
April | July (Prime Day) | 8.9-13.6% more off | Yes, if not urgent |
May | July (Prime Day) | 10.5-13.2% more off | Yes, if not urgent |
June | July (Prime Day) | 14.2-18.3% more off | Yes, worth short wait |
July | November (Black Friday) | 8.8-13.7% more off | Yes, if not urgent |
August | November (Black Friday) | 13.1-18.4% more off | Yes, if not urgent |
September | November (Black Friday) | 12.7-18.1% more off | Yes, if not urgent |
October | November (Black Friday) | 9.1-13.8% more off | Yes, worth short wait |
November | Next July | Likely none | No, buy now! |
December | Next July | 5.4-9.4% more off | No, minimal savings |
As you can see, if you're shopping in October, waiting just a few weeks until Black Friday can save you 9.1-13.8% more. However, if you're shopping in December, you'll likely need to wait until July for the next significant price drop.
WiFi technology advances regularly, with major standards like WiFi 6, WiFi 6E, and now WiFi 7 hitting the market every few years. Consider these technology cycles when timing your purchase:
If you're looking for the latest technology, consider this strategy: Buy the previous generation immediately after new standards are released. For example, WiFi 6E routers saw significant price drops when WiFi 7 models were announced, offering excellent value for most users.

Several industry trends are currently influencing router pricing:
Growing Market: The WiFi router market is projected to reach between $15.05 billion and $54.9 billion by 2032, with a CAGR of 6.4-11.8%. This growth is driving competition and more frequent sales.
Remote Work Impact: The shift to remote work has increased demand for high-performance home networking equipment, keeping prices relatively stable for newer models despite their age.
WiFi 6 and WiFi 7 Adoption: As newer standards become available, previous-generation routers see accelerated price drops. WiFi 6 routers are now regularly discounted as WiFi 6E and WiFi 7 models take the premium position.

The ideal buying strategy: Target Black Friday for premium/high-end routers and mesh systems, and Amazon Prime Day for mid-range and budget routers. If you need a router between these events, April and September offer more modest but still worthwhile discounts.
Remember that while timing matters, your network needs should be the priority. A few weeks of improved connectivity might be worth paying a little extra rather than struggling with an outdated or malfunctioning router while waiting for the next big sale.
